ARTHUR ABRAHAM TO TAKE ON KHOREN GEVOR IN SECOND MANDATORY TITLE DEFENCE

EastsideBoxing.com
June 13 2007

13.06.07 – It was at the training camp on Majorca where Arthur Abraham
learned about his next opponent – the undefeated IBF middleweight
champion will make his second mandatory defence against Universum´s
Khoren Gevor. "That is no surprise for me," King Arthur stated. "I
only took one week off in Armenia after my last fight and then started
practicing straight away. I will be ready."

Some weeks ago Gevor did not look like a potential Abraham opponent
as he is only rated fifth by the IBF. But with Edison Miranda,
the original mandatory challenger, losing and European champion
Amin Asikainen taking on Sebastian Sylvester in Zwickau on June 23,
Gevor has been made mandatory challenger. "Of course Arthur is the
favourite," coach Ulli Wegner said.

"One must not underestimate Gevor, though, even though his name might
only ring a bell with a few experts. He is fundamentally sound and
a strong fighter. Arthur should not take him lightly."

The fight will also spell only the second duel between coaching
legends Ulli Wegner and Universum´s Fritz Sdunek. "We have known
each other for ages," said Wegner. "Back in the GDR, we competed in
many fights. I have a lot of respect for him and truly appreciate the
work he is doing for Universum." Their only meeting in professional
boxing came in November 2000 when Vitali Klitschko clinched a points
decision over Wegner´s Timo Hoffmann.

Abraham´s training camp on Majorca will come to an end this weekend.

"Then we will start with the video analysis and get Arthur in perfect
shape in Berlin," Wegner said. Time, date and the promoting organizers
for the fight still have to be determined. "We have already picked
up the negotiations with Universum," Sauerland managing director
Chris Meyer said. "Of course it is our goal to stage the fight of
our champion." If all goes according to plan for Sauerland Event,
the fight will go down in Germany in August.
